A company lowering prices to attract more customers is focusing on:
Survival
Brand image
Market share
Skimming
All Answers 1
Answered by
GPT-5 mini
AI
Market share.
Lowering prices is typically used to attract more customers and increase sales volume and share of the market. (It’s not skimming — that’s high pricing — and while price cuts can be for survival or affect brand image, the primary objective in this scenario is increasing market share.)
